Pertussis toxin, cholera toxin and forskolin, all of which can increase adenylate cyclase activity, stimulated luteinizing hormone LH release from cultured rat anterior pituitary cells. Although cellular cyclic AMP and growth hormone were increased rapidly by cholera toxin and forskolin, enhanced LH release occurred significantly later with no change in total radioimmunoassayable LH (i.e., released plus stored). These data suggest that changes in cyclic AMP levels may regulate the tonic availability of releasable LH in the gonadotroph.
